A modern household can easily contain dozens of connected devices, from thermostats and security cameras to kitchen appliances and wearables. In industrial settings, the number rises into the hundreds or thousands.<\/p>\n<p data-start=\"2338\" data-end=\"2681\">These devices are in constant communication, sending telemetry data to cloud platforms, receiving commands from mobile apps, or interacting with each other directly. Yet while traditional IT security teams dedicate significant resources to protecting laptops, servers, and mobile phones, IoT devices are often overlooked or poorly monitored.<\/p>\n<p data-start=\"2683\" data-end=\"3137\">Many IoT systems run lightweight operating systems that lack detailed logging. They may generate only minimal error messages, or none at all. When <a href=\"https:\/\/areeblog.com\/top-6-most-common-types-of-malware-attacks\/\">malware<\/a> infects a device or unusual traffic patterns emerge, there may be no records for analysts to review. Worse, IoT devices are regularly deployed in remote or unattended locations, such as oil rigs, retail kiosks, smart meters, or even city streetlights, where physical inspection is rare and costly.<\/p>\n<p data-start=\"3139\" data-end=\"3463\">The result is a sprawling landscape of blind spots. Organizations frequently don\u2019t know how many devices they own, much less whether those devices are patched or protected by strong credentials. Unless IoT is treated as a critical security frontier, attackers will continue to exploit these overlooked endpoints with ease.<\/p>\n<h2 data-start=\"3470\" data-end=\"3503\">Why IoT Devices Are Vulnerable<\/h2>\n<p data-start=\"3505\" data-end=\"3732\">IoT devices didn\u2019t become vulnerable by accident. Their weaknesses stem from design priorities, market pressures, and technical limitations. Below are the ten most common reasons these devices are prime targets for attackers:<\/p>\n<ol data-start=\"3734\" data-end=\"5273\">\n<li data-start=\"3734\" data-end=\"3907\">\n<p data-start=\"3737\" data-end=\"3907\"><strong data-start=\"3737\" data-end=\"3764\">Lack of Security Focus:<\/strong> Manufacturers prioritize speed-to-market and consumer-friendly features. Security often comes as an afterthought, if it\u2019s considered at all.<\/p>\n<\/li>\n<li data-start=\"3908\" data-end=\"4069\">\n<p data-start=\"3911\" data-end=\"4069\"><strong data-start=\"3911\" data-end=\"3937\">Vulnerable Components:<\/strong> To reduce costs, devices rely on mass-market chips and open-source libraries. A single flaw can cascade across millions of units.<\/p>\n<\/li>\n<li data-start=\"4070\" data-end=\"4244\">\n<p data-start=\"4073\" data-end=\"4244\"><strong data-start=\"4073\" data-end=\"4112\">Weak Authentication and Encryption:<\/strong> Default credentials like admin\/admin persist, and some devices can\u2019t even change passwords. Data frequently travels in plaintext.<\/p>\n<\/li>\n<li data-start=\"4245\" data-end=\"4374\">\n<p data-start=\"4248\" data-end=\"4374\"><strong data-start=\"4248\" data-end=\"4283\">Outdated Firmware and Software:<\/strong> Updates are manual, clunky, or simply never issued, leaving devices perpetually exposed.<\/p>\n<\/li>\n<li data-start=\"4375\" data-end=\"4545\">\n<p data-start=\"4378\" data-end=\"4545\"><strong data-start=\"4378\" data-end=\"4408\">Lack of Device Management:<\/strong> Traditional endpoint management tools don\u2019t support IoT. Without a standard, organizations can\u2019t inventory or enforce policies easily.<\/p>\n<\/li>\n<li data-start=\"4546\" data-end=\"4707\">\n<p data-start=\"4549\" data-end=\"4707\"><strong data-start=\"4549\" data-end=\"4588\">Insecure Data Transfer and Storage:<\/strong> Logs, credentials, and configuration files may be stored unencrypted, while communications use unprotected channels.<\/p>\n<\/li>\n<li data-start=\"4708\" data-end=\"4851\">\n<p data-start=\"4711\" data-end=\"4851\"><strong data-start=\"4711\" data-end=\"4740\">Physical Vulnerabilities:<\/strong> Debug ports and open connectors provide attackers with easy firmware access if they gain physical proximity.<\/p>\n<\/li>\n<li data-start=\"4852\" data-end=\"4989\">\n<p data-start=\"4855\" data-end=\"4989\"><strong data-start=\"4855\" data-end=\"4888\">Exposure to External Attacks:<\/strong> Internet-facing IoT systems are continuously scanned, making them quick prey for botnet operators.<\/p>\n<\/li>\n<li data-start=\"4990\" data-end=\"5118\">\n<p data-start=\"4993\" data-end=\"5118\"><strong data-start=\"4993\" data-end=\"5020\">Lack of User Awareness:<\/strong> Many users don\u2019t view IoT devices as computers and fail to update firmware or change passwords.<\/p>\n<\/li>\n<li data-start=\"5119\" data-end=\"5273\">\n<p data-start=\"5123\" data-end=\"5273\"><strong data-start=\"5123\" data-end=\"5154\">Complexity of IoT Networks:<\/strong> Multiple protocols (Zigbee, Z-Wave, MQTT, CoAP, etc.) expand the attack surface with new quirks and vulnerabilities.<\/p>\n<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<p data-start=\"5275\" data-end=\"5353\">Every additional device means another doorway into your digital environment.<\/p>\n<h2 data-start=\"5360\" data-end=\"5385\">Trends in IoT Security<\/h2>\n<p data-start=\"5387\" data-end=\"5511\">While the threat landscape is evolving, so are the defenses. Three key trends stand out in today\u2019s IoT security ecosystem:<\/p>\n<p data-start=\"5513\" data-end=\"5867\"><strong data-start=\"5513\" data-end=\"5556\">1. Rise of AI-Powered Threat Detection: <\/strong>Machine learning models can build behavioral profiles of IoT devices, tracking normal traffic volumes, communication patterns, and destinations. When anomalies occur (e.g., a sensor suddenly sending data to an unknown IP at 3 a.m.), real-time alerts can catch attacks that signature-based tools would miss.<\/p>\n<p data-start=\"5869\" data-end=\"6157\"><strong data-start=\"5869\" data-end=\"5906\">2. Managed IoT Security Services: <\/strong>Small and mid-sized organizations often lack the staff to continuously monitor devices. Managed service providers now offer 24\/7 device discovery, monitoring, and incident response, giving enterprises access to expertise without massive overhead.<\/p>\n<p data-start=\"6159\" data-end=\"6257\"><strong data-start=\"6159\" data-end=\"6194\">3. Zero-Trust for IoT Networks: <\/strong>Zero-trust principles extend naturally to IoT.
